Washington State Presents Awards, Crowns Best Bagger During Annual Reception

The Washington Food Industry Association (WFIA) presented several awards and crowned the state’s best bagger during the group’s annual industry reception in Spokane on Oct. 27. NGA Presents Great American Award To Wakefern’s Mottese

The National Grocers Association (NGA) has recognized Wakefern Food Corp.’s Lorelei Mottese with NGA’s highest award for government relations, the Clarence G. Adamy Great American Award. Rouses Becomes Official Grocer Of NBA Team

The New Orleans Pelicans on Thursday said that Rouses will be the Official Grocer of the New Orleans Pelicans for the 2015-16 NBA season. Schnucks To Open New Evansville, Indiana, Store, On Nov. 11

Tony’s Fresh Market Is IFRA’s 2015 Industry Retailer Award Recipient

Tony’s Fresh Market is the Illinois Food Retailers Association (IFRA) 2015 Industry Retailer Award recipient. Supervalu Reports 2Q Fiscal 2016 Results

Minneapolis-based Supervalu on Wednesday reported second quarter fiscal 2016 net sales of $4.06 billion and net earnings from continuing operations of $31 million, or $0.11 per diluted share, which included $6 million in after-tax costs related to the potential separation of Save-A-Lot and severance costs.
